What is the correct verb in Maria Elena la televisión?

A) Ve
B) Miras
C) Es
D) Hace

Final answer:

The correct verb to complete the sentence 'Maria Elena la televisión' is 've' because it agrees with the third person singular subject 'Maria Elena'. 'Ve' is the present tense form of 'ver', which means 'to watch'. The correct sentence is 'Maria Elena ve la televisión,' translating to 'Maria Elena watches the television.'

Step-by-step explanation:

The correct verb to complete the sentence "Maria Elena la televisión" is "ve". This is because the subject of the sentence is "Maria Elena", which is a third-person singular pronoun, and in Spanish, the verb must agree with the subject in both number and person. The verb "ve" is the third person singular present tense form of "ver", which means "to see" or "to watch". In this context, it would translate to "Maria Elena watches the television."

It is important to choose the right verb to ensure the sentence is grammatically correct and conveys the thought. The other options provided, "miras", "es", and "hace", are incorrect because they do not agree with the third-person singular subject. "Miras" is the second person singular present tense form of "mirar", which would mean "you watch", "es" is the third person singular present tense of "ser", which means "is", and "hace" is the third person singular present tense of "hacer", which means "makes" or "does".

To use "ve" correctly in the sentence, it would be: "Maria Elena ve la televisión," which means "Maria Elena watches the television." This clearly explains that the action of watching the television is being performed by Maria Elena.
